    33 4.1.10 . ISO This option is equivalent to the film speed setting on film cameras. In brighter conditions , a low ISO film is needed, correspondingly, in darker conditions, a high ISO film is needed. 1. Turn the camera on an d ensure it is in Photo mode . 2.     44 Appendix Specifications General Imaging sensor Panasonic 5.3 Megapixel CCD sensor Active pixels 5.0 Megapixel Storage media Buil t-in 32 MB Flash memory SD/MMC card (32/64/128/256/512 MB/1GB) Sensor sensitiv ity Auto, ISO 100, 200, 400 equivalent, user definable Lens 3X optical zoom lens Wide: F/2.8~3.9, f=6.3mm Tele: F/4.9~7.0, f=18.9 mm Focus ...

    45 General Zoom 3x optical zoom, 4x digital zo om TFT Monitor 2.0” TFT high resolution (480 x 240 pixels) Flash 0.6~2.5m range Off/Auto/Force/Slow Sync/Force Red Eye Reduction/ Auto Red Eye Reduction White balance Auto/Sunny/Cloudy/Tungsten/Fluoresc ent EV compensation -2.0 EV~+2.0 EV (in 0.2 EV steps) Self timer 10 seconds PC interface USB 2.0, ...
